Bruno Le Maire and his fellow EU finance ministers must smile. This Thursday, they reached agreement on a joint economic response to the coronavirus. Common ground was found with the Netherlands, which has blocked talks since Tuesday, AFP learned from concordant sources.
"The meeting ended with the applause of the ministers," the spokesperson for the president of the Eurogroup announced on Twitter.
Excellent agreement between European finance ministers on the economic response to #Coronavirus: 500 billion euros available immediately. A stimulus fund to come. Europe decides and is up to the seriousness of the crisis.
- Bruno Le Maire (@BrunoLeMaire) April 9, 2020The French Minister of Economy and Finance, Bruno Le Maire, welcomed him an "excellent agreement" including "500 billion euros available immediately" and "a stimulus fund to come".
